How to join

To join, you must:

  • be majoring in a program in the Faculty of Science
  • have completed your first year of study
  • have a minimum B average
  • be a full-time UVic student
  • enrol in SCIE 201 by September 15

We suggest you join at the end of your first year of courses so that you can alternate terms in class with terms working with employers. This gives you more options in terms of when you complete your work terms.

If you're later in your degree, you can still participate in co-op but your schedule may look different. Contact your co-op coordinator to discuss possibilities.  

Science graduate students are also eligible for co-op. Please speak to your supervisor about your plans.

If you've registered for SCIE 201 by September 15, you'll get access to a checklist of tasks to complete to be accepted into Science Co-op. 

Once you're accepted

You'll begin your co-op education through SCIE 201: Introduction to Professional Practice classes, which you'll take once before your first work term. 

The course takes place in the winter session in addition to the regular course load. It includes 50-minute in-person/synchronous sessions and a mock interview clinic.

The goal of the course is to give you baseline tools and skills to help you in your co-op (and later, full-time) job hunt. You'll learn about the hiring process, passive and active search options, résumé and cover letter writing, professionalism and ethics, interview skills, networking skills and how to be successful on your work term.

You only need to take SCIE 201 once.

After your work term

At the end of your co-op work term, you will reflect on your work experience by completing a:

  • work term report - a scientific report on a subject you chose with your work term supervisor
  • oral presentation - a short presentation to an audience of your peers
  • competency assessment – a tool that is part of the co-op and career portal

You should also: 

  • book a debriefing meeting
  • update your résumé
  • complete a release form

Assignment due dates:

  • work term ending in August: due September 15
  • work term ending in December: due January 15
  • work term ending in April: due May 15

If the due date falls on a holiday or a weekend, the assignment will be due the next business day.

Average salaries

You'll receive a salary from your employer during each co-op work term. Co-op salaries vary according to many factors, including:

  • your previous work experience
  • the industry you're working in
  • the responsibilities of your co-op job

Here are average monthly salaries for a work term:

  • Biology: $2,958.72
  • Biochemistry and Microbiology: $2,880.61
  • Chemistry: $2,931.40
  • Earth and Ocean Sciences: $3,338.95
  • Physics and Astronomy: $3,127.85
  • Mathematics undergraduate: $3,070.28
  • Mathematics graduate: $4,168.00
  • Statistics undergraduate: $3,070.28
  • Statistics graduate: $4,168.00

Fees

Co-op students pay a co-op tuition fee for each work term. It's free to join co-op and attend the preparation course—you'll pay your tuition fee after you secure a co-op work term.

You'll pay your fees according to the same tuition fee deadlines as regular course fees.

Fees per work term for undergraduate students:

  • domestic students: $776.20
  • international students: $1,510.16

Fees per work term for graduate students:

  • domestic students: $776.20
  • international students: $976.27

Note that the graduate co-op tuition fee is different than the graduate installment fee. If you are a grad student and register for a co-op work term, during that term, you'll pay:

  • the grad co-op program fee  
  • the grad ancillary fees

If you register for a course (e.g. thesis 596 or 598) and a co-op work term in the same term, during that term, you'll pay:

  • the grad co-op program tuition fee
  • the course tuition fee
  • the grad ancillary fees

Transfer students

If you've completed a co-op work term at another accredited post-secondary institution, you can apply for transfer credit (or a work term transfer) for up to 2 work terms.

The work term that you want to receive transfer credit for must have been:

  • paid
  • evaluated (you submitted a final written report)
  • supervised by a co-op practitioner
  • a minimum of 4 months (or 420 hours) of full-time work
  • relevant to your academic program

Previous work experience

You can apply to register previous work you completed before entering the co-op program as a work term challenge, for up to 2 work terms.

The work must have:

  • been completed before acceptance into the Science Co-op Program
  • helped you establish and achieve your career goals
  • been supervised
  • totalled a minimum of 420 hours
  • been paid
  • helped you develop competencies, such as:
    • analysis
    • problem-solving
    • decision-making
    • organizing/managing self and others
    • written/verbal communication
    • technical/computer
    • interpersonal relations
    • initiative and self-reliance
    • industry/job specific
